Arcturus UAV specialized in the design and production of small to medium-sized tactical unmanned aircraft systems for military and commercial applications. The company developed several UAV platforms including the Arcturus T-20 and T-15 models before being acquired by AeroVironment, a leading provider of unmanned aircraft systems and electric vehicle charging solutions.
Following the acquisition, Arcturus UAV operations were integrated into AeroVironment's portfolio, contributing to the parent company's tactical UAS offerings for defense and government customers.
Arcturus UAV was founded as an independent company developing tactical unmanned aircraft systems. The company gained recognition for its work on medium-range tactical UAVs before being acquired by AeroVironment in 2013, after which it operated as a subsidiary/division of AeroVironment.
